What affects the price

Landscaping costs depend on the specific needs of your property. Factors that shift the price include the square footage of the area, the complexity of your design, and the type of materials you choose, such as natural stone versus concrete pavers. Labor costs fluctuate based on site accessibility and the amount of grading or drainage work required before planting begins.

A landscaping supplier is a business that stocks bulk materials like mulch, soil, gravel, and pavers. You need one when you are ready to start a DIY project or need to replenish materials for your garden beds. They provide the raw supplies you need to build or maintain your outdoor space.
